How Subsurface Fatigue Leads to Bearing Failure

Bearing failure doesn’t begin when you hear a noisy bearing or see visible damage. It often starts much earlier, beneath the surface, where repeated stress can create microscopic cracks that eventually lead to spalling and failure. This whitepaper takes a closer look at how subsurface fatigue develops, the factors that influence bearing life, and what’s really happening inside a bearing as it begins to deteriorate.

You’ll also explore how condition monitoring technologies, including ultrasound, can help detect these subtle changes early, giving maintenance teams the insight they need to make better decisions about lubrication, bearing replacement, and overall asset reliability.
